Output 8b955290b61337d531529cecced22411749035e60a262be21f141a8fe19d9866:1

value
508049
script pubkey
OP_0 OP_PUSHBYTES_20 3bc1464d10ac1e875a49f18a80a80a2d7d4a7baf
address
bc1q80q5vngs4s0gwkjf7x9gp2q2947557a0wlkj9z
transaction
8b955290b61337d531529cecced22411749035e60a262be21f141a8fe19d9866